English term or phrase: series accounting
The Fund does not apply an equalisation methodology at Shareholder level (such as ** series accounting ** or equalisation shares) with regards to the Performance Fee calculation.
Mario Altare
Local time: 10:41
Series accounting (metodo di calcolo con NAV multipla)
Explanation:
In order to calculate the Performance Fee, the Series Accounting method produces a NAV (net asset value) each time an investor subscribes to the fund, hence using different series of shares within each class.

Ex.
Series 1 - Sub.price 1.00 - NAV 1.10 - Perf. Fee (20%)=0.02
Series 2 - Sub.price 1.05 - NAV 1.10 - Perf. Fee (20%)=0.01

Therefore, I'd keep the English term adding the italian "rewording" in brackets
